Nyko Technologies, the rather inventive accessories manufacturer, today announced the launch of the Intercooler Grip for Xbox One, a high-quality cooler attachment for controllers with built-in fans and its own rechargeable battery. With a low profile design that fits comfortably in the hands without interfering with gameplay, Intercooler Grip introduces airflow to help fight sweaty palms. The Intercooler Grip for Xbox One is now available at Amazon for $20.

“Controllers can become slippery and hard to use during extended gameplay sessions due to sweat,” said Chris Arbogast, Nyko’s Director of Sales and Marketing. “We’ve solved this problem by bringing our console Intercooler technology to controllers, delivering airflow to the player’s palms with a discreet cooling fan.”

The Intercooler Grip simply fastens to the bottom of an Xbox One controller, cooling the user’s hands during intense gaming sessions. Its cool, quiet performance and flush design allow it to fit seamlessly onto the controller without impeding on its original feel. Intercooler Grip comes with a built-in rechargeable battery that does not draw power from the controller, and is charged using the included micro-USB cable.
